Nuclear physics around the unitarity limit

In the unitarity (or unitary) limit, where the two-nucleon S-wave channels have infinite scattering lengths and zero-energy bound states, only one dimensionful parameter is left and set by the triton binding energy. While the proximity of the real world to this idealized scenario has been discussed qualitatively for a long time, it has traditionally not played any special role in constructing nuclear forces. Here it is argued that at least light nuclei may reside in a sweet spot: bound weakly enough to be insensitive to the details of the interaction, but dense enough to be insensitive to the exact values of the large two-body scattering lengths as well, so that a systematic expansion around the unitarity limit converges. With this, the gross features of states in the nuclear chart are determined by a very simple leading-order interaction, whereas - much like the fine structure of atomic spectra - observables are moved to their physical values by small perturbative corrections. Explicit evidence in favor of this conjecture is shown for the binding energies of three and four nucleons.
